Position Overview:
The Managing Director will lead investment strategies, manage portfolio companies, and drive firm growth. This role requires a deep understanding of private equity, strong leadership skills, and a proven track record of successful deal sourcing and execution.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Investment Strategy: Develop and execute investment strategies aligned with the firm's objectives, including sourcing, evaluating, and executing investment opportunities.

  • Leadership: Lead a team of investment professionals, providing mentorship and fostering a high-performance culture.

  • Portfolio Management: Oversee the performance of portfolio companies, working closely with management teams to implement value creation initiatives.

  • Stakeholder Engagement: Build and maintain relationships with limited partners, industry experts, and potential co-investors.

  • Market Analysis: Stay abreast of market trends, industry developments, and competitive landscapes to inform investment decisions.

  • Due Diligence: Direct comprehensive due diligence processes for potential investments, including financial modeling and risk assessment.

  • Reporting: Prepare and present investment proposals and performance reports to the firm's investment committee and stakeholders.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Business, or a related field; MBA or advanced degree preferred.
  • 10+ years of experience in private equity, investment banking, or corporate finance.
  • Proven track record of leading successful investments and managing teams.
  • Strong analytical, negotiation, and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, high-pressure environment.
